首页小程序开发小程序定制报价微信小程序定制

报价微信小程序定制

2026-06-02

昆明

返回列表

在数字化商业浪潮中,微信小程序以其无需下载、即用即走的轻量化特性,已成为企业连接客户、优化服务流程的关键触点。对于涉及复杂产品与服务报价的行业而言,如工程建筑、定制化制造、专业咨询、IT解决方案等,一款功能完备、逻辑严谨的报价小程序,不仅是提升销售效率的工具,更是企业专业形象与数字化能力的重要体现。本文旨在系统阐述企业级报价微信小程序的定制化开发,聚焦其核心业务诉求、技术架构设计、关键功能模块以及项目实施中的风险管理,为相关决策与开发提供专业参考。

一、 报价小程序的核心业务诉求与价值定位

企业定制报价小程序,其根本目的在于将传统线下或非标准化的报价流程,迁移至线上并实现标准化、自动化与智能化。其核心业务诉求可归纳为以下几点:

1. 流程标准化与效率提升:通过预设的报价模板、参数化配置引擎与自动化计算规则,将销售人员的经验性判断转化为系统逻辑,大幅缩短报价周期,减少人为误差,确保报价的一致性与规范性。

2. 客户体验优化与交互深化:为客户提供7×24小时的自助询价与方案获取渠道。直观的产品/服务配置界面、实时变动的价格预览、清晰的费用明细分解,能够显著增强客户参与感与信任度,加速决策进程。

3. 数据资产沉淀与商业智能分析:报价过程自然产生并结构化存储海量数据,包括客户偏好、高频配置选项、价格敏感区间、询价转化路径等。这些数据经过清洗与分析,可反哺产品定价策略、优化库存管理、识别潜在市场趋势,构成企业重要的数据资产。

4. 销售团队赋能与管理强化:系统可集成客户关系管理(CRM)模块,实现报价与的无缝衔接。管理者能够实时追踪报价状态、分析销售人员绩效、监控项目成本利润,实现精细化管理。

二、 系统架构设计与关键技术选型

为实现上述业务价值,报价小程序的系统架构需具备高可用性、可扩展性与安全性。通常采用前后端分离的微服务架构。

1. 前端架构(微信小程序端)

技术栈:基于微信官方开启者工具,使用WXML、WXSS、JavaScript/TypeScript,并可选用Vue.js风格的框架(如uni-app、Taro)或React风格框架(如Remax)进行跨端开发,以提升开发效率与代码复用率。

核心组件:构建丰富的表单组件(如动态增减的表单项、条件显示字段)、可视化配置器(如拖拽式方案组装)、实时计算与预览面板。需特别注重交互的流畅性与数据的即时反馈,避免因复杂计算导致的界面卡顿。

状态管理:对于配置参数、临时计算结果等复杂状态,需引入如MobX或Redux模式的状态管理库,确保数据流清晰、可预测。

2. 后端服务架构

微服务划分:可划分为用户鉴权服务、产品/服务目录服务、定价引擎服务、报价单管理服务、订单处理服务、数据报表服务等。各服务独立部署、弹性伸缩。

定价引擎:这是系统的核心逻辑层。需设计灵活的规则引擎,支持基于成本加成、市场竞争、客户等级、数量阶梯、动态系数(如原材料价格波动)等多种定价模型的组合与计算。规则应以配置化的方式存在,便于业务人员调整而非依赖代码修改。

数据持久化:采用关系型数据库(如MySQL、PostgreSQL)存储结构化业务数据(客户、产品、报价单)。对于复杂的配置关系与快速检索需求,可结合使用文档型数据库(如MongoDB)或缓存数据库(如Redis)。

API设计与安全:提供RESTful或GraphQL接口供小程序调用。必须实施严格的API网关防护,包括HTTPS传输、请求限流、身份认证(微信登录结合自定义Token)、参数校验与防SQL注入等安全措施。

3. 管理与后台架构

需提供功能雄厚的Web管理后台,供企业内部管理员、销售经理、产品经理使用。用于管理产品库、配置定价规则、审核报价、查看统计分析报表等。通常采用React、Vue等前端框架配合后端API构建。

三、 关键功能模块详述

一个完整的企业级报价小程序应包含以下核心功能模块:

1. 用户中心与权限体系:集成微信一键登录,并建立企业自有账户体系。实现基于角色(如销售、经理、管理员)的细粒度权限控制,不同角色可见可操作的功能与数据范围不同。

2. 产品/服务配置器:这是用户交互的核心。以图形化、步骤式向导引导客户选择产品型号、规格参数、附加服务、交付周期等选项。每个选项的选择都可能联动影响其他选项的可用性及蕞终价格。

3. 智能定价与实时计算引擎:后台根据用户配置,实时调用定价规则引擎,计算基础价格、折扣、税费、运费等,并迅速在前端显示总价与明细。支持生成“假设分析”,让客户看到不同选择下的价格差异。

4. 报价单生成与管理:配置完成后,系统自动生成结构清晰、格式专业的PDF版报价单,包含企业Logo、条款说明、有效期等。报价单具有仅此编号,状态可追踪(如已发送、客户已查看、已接受、已过期)。

5. CRM与商机管理轻集成:将报价行为自动关联至客户档案,记录完整的询价历史。报价单的接受可直接转化为销售机会或订单草稿,实现销售漏斗的线上化流转。

6. 数据分析与看板:后台提供多维数据分析报表,如报价成功率分析、热门配置分析、平均报价时长、销售人员业绩排行等,以数据驱动业务优化。

四、 定制化实施路径与风险管理

定制开发报价小程序是一项系统工程,需遵循科学的实施路径并管控风险。

1. 需求调研与方案设计阶段:深入业务部门,梳理所有报价场景、例外情况、审批流程。输出详尽的产品需求文档(PRD)与交互原型,明确业务规则,这是项目成功的基础。

2. 敏捷开发与迭代交付:采用敏捷开发模式,将功能拆分为若干迭代周期。优先开发核心的配置与报价流程(MVP),尽快上线试运行,收集用户反馈,再逐步迭代增加高级功能(如复杂折扣规则、集成ERP)。

3. 数据迁移与系统集成:规划好从旧系统(如Excel、现有CRM)向新小程序的数据迁移方案。明确与现有企业系统(如ERP、财务软件)的集成接口与数据同步机制,避免形成信息孤岛。

4. 测试与部署:进行全面的单元测试、集成测试、性能测试(特别是高并发报价计算场景)与安全测试。制定详细的部署上线与回滚计划。

5. 主要风险与应对

业务逻辑复杂性风险:定价规则过于复杂或频繁变更。应对:在设计中强化规则引擎的可配置性,将业务逻辑与程序代码分离。

性能风险:实时计算导致响应延迟。应对:对计算过程进行算法优化,对常用结果进行缓存,采用异步计算处理超复杂场景。

用户接受度风险:线下销售人员不愿使用或客户不适应线上流程。应对:加强培训,设计极简的用户界面,并设置过渡期与线下辅助通道。

企业级报价微信小程序的定制开发,绝非简单的表单搬运,而是一个涉及业务重塑、技术架构与用户体验深度融合的系统工程。其成功关键在于前期对业务逻辑的深度抽象与标准化,中期对核心定价引擎与配置器的稳健设计,以及后期持续的数据运营与迭代优化。通过构建这样一套系统,企业不仅能实现报价流程的数字化与自动化,更能借此沉淀核心业务数据,赋能销售团队,蕞终在提升运营效率的构建起可持续的数字化竞争优势。项目的实施需秉持严谨的项目管理方法,平衡功能、成本、时间与风险,方能确保交付成果真正契合业务发展所需。